Hotline Miami Release Date Confirmed, Exclusive Content Detailed

Sony has revealed that Hotline Miami will be releasing on the PS3 and PS Vita next week in both North America and Europe. The game will launch in North America on June 25th for $9.99, and in Europe on June 26th for £7.29 / €8.99. In addition, the PlayStation versions of the game will have an exclusive new mask designed by Abstraction and Dennaton Games.
Patched PS3 Firmware v4.45 to be Released Next Week

Sony has promised to release a fixed version of PS3 Firmware v4.45 next week, which caused PS3s to brick earlier this week. Sony has identified the issue in the firmware causing PS3s to break, and will be releasing the updated version of the firmware on June 27th, 2013.
Rumor Alert: Sony Adding Privacy Options to Trophies

Recent rumours suggest that Sony are working on new privacy settings for the PS3 and PS4 to allow users to hide their Trophy count and lists from other users. At the moment, trophy information is publicly available for any PSN user, meaning anyone can look at what games you’ve been playing.
PS4 Teaser Was Most Viewed YouTube Video in May in the UK

Sony’s PS4 teaser trailer was the most viewed YouTube clip in the UK last month according to Marketing Week. The video racked up over 7.6 million views in just over a month, beating Call of Duty’s “Masked Warriors” clip, and an advert from Specsavers, which hasn’t even hit 1 million views yet.

Sony Releases FAQs on Firmware v4.45 Bricking

Following the release of PS3 Firmware v4.45 yesterday, Sony has provided FAQs on those affected with bricked consoles on what to do next. Unfortunately, Sony is still investigating the issue leading to broken consoles, so the answers aren’t that helpful, with most just saying “We kindly ask PS3 users to wait for further details. We will announce when ready.”

Battlefield 3 and Saints Row: The Third Coming to PlayStation Plus in July

Sony Europe has revealed that five new games are coming to PlayStation Plus in July, including Battlefield 3 for the PS3 and Ninja Gaiden Sigma Plus for the PS Vita. All five of the new games will be released to the store on July 3rd, 2013. Following on from the US, Saints Row: The Third will also be made available in the Instant Game Collection next month.
